Demo

17Software Developer 2

Dee Zee
Des Moines, IA Full Time
POSTED ON 2/6/2025
AVAILABLE BEFORE 4/5/2025
POSITION SUMMARY — Analyze, design, develop, test, document, and implement new or existing software to meet ongoing software development needs. Ability to manage integration between various business systems and provide in-depth technical and business knowledge to handle complex issues. Ensure software meets business requirements, follows development standards, and maintains data integrity. Follow established processes for the software development life cycle with a customer focus delivering software and system solutions. Exhibits strong communication skills with a passion for customer support in interacting with product owners, and acts with a sense of urgency when warranted. Train and mentor software developers on intermediate to advanced programming techniques and standards. Reasonable accommodations may be made to enable qualified individuals with disabilities to perform the essential functions.   WORK ENVIRONMENT — Must be willing and able to work in an environment exposed to elements that can include but are not limited to coolant, dust, mist, elevated noise, and uncontrolled temperatures.    ESSENTIAL FUNCTIONS Design, code, test, debug, document, and implement changes to new and existing software applications using C#, VB.NET, MVC, T-SQL, SSRS, SSIS, Entity Framework, Dapper, CSS, Bootstrap, JavaScript, jQuery, JSON, Web API and SignalR as well as other technologies as needed Create, maintain, and modify SQL server databases, indexes, jobs, and security Conduct thorough testing of programs and software applications to ensure the desired results and that the requirements were met Manage code within source control to ensure data integrity and recoverability Mentor software developers on source control branching techniques and pull requests Code review source control pull requests to provide guidance and training to software developers Perform modifications, bug fixes, and enhancements of existing programs to increase operating efficiency or adapt to new requirements Refactor code to improve speed, maintainability, and readability Take ownership of business system maintenance tasks and complete them independently Ability to search the Internet to find solutions to technical problems Consult with managerial, engineering, technical personnel, and end users to clarify program intent, identify problems, and recommend improvements Perform impact analysis to assess risk when making code changes to integrated business systems Concisely and accurately document technical and business processes and self-document code to clearly state its intent to other developers Prepare detailed flow charts and mockups that translate complex technical workflows into a format that is easily understood by end users and convert them into a computer program Lead development projects through the entire system development lifecycle with minimal input from senior developers and management Consult with and assist customers to define and resolve problems in computer programs Develop applications that interface with SQL Server databases and develop SQL Server Reporting Services (SSRS) labels and reports Write professional, polished instructions or manuals to guide end users Ability to quickly assess a business problem and provide accurate time estimates Availability for after-hours support on an as needed or rotating basis Other duties as assigned Ability to stop the production line and prevent shipment of products due to nonconformance or potential nonconformance products to our customers Support the environmental policy with proactive process implementation, improvement suggestions, reducing waste, and acting on environment performance results and findings  SKILLS & ABILITIES Extensive computer skills Strong aptitude to learn new systems and business systems interfaces Ability to work either as a team or independently Train and mentor software developers Experience with and supportive of Agile methods Detail oriented Excellent problem solving and analytical abilities Customer service oriented Strong communication skills Ability to search the Internet to find solutions to technical problems Ability to multitask and prioritize, focusing on the business needs    POSITION QUALIFICATIONS Education: Bachelor’s degree is preferred, any degree or technical schooling would be an advantage Experience: Five to ten years of IT software development experience in C#, VB.NET, and T-SQL preferred; experience in a manufacturing environment and supporting ERP systems would be an advantage. Experience working in an agile environment is a plus. Computer Skills: Must demonstrate computer literacy; experience with and understanding of Microsoft Visual Studio using C# and VB.NET, MVC, Azure DevOps, Web Services, Git source control, T-SQL, relational databases (Microsoft SQL Server), Microsoft SSMS, SSRS and SSIS, ERP software,mobile device (barcode scanners) development, warehouse management systems, Clippership/Kewill Integration, Microsoft Office, and Fourth Shift. Knowledge of CSS, Bootstrap, Entity Framework, Dapper, Web API, jQuery, JSON, SignalR, Electronic Data Interchange (EDI), Adobe Photoshop, and Paint.NET is a plus.

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a 17Software Developer 2?

Sign up to receive alerts about other jobs on the 17Software Developer 2 career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$88,790 - $110,816
Income Estimation: 
$107,385 - $134,565
Income Estimation: 
$107,385 - $134,565
Income Estimation: 
$128,473 - $158,030
Income Estimation: 
$72,538 - $87,299
Income Estimation: 
$88,790 - $110,816
Income Estimation: 
$128,473 - $158,030
Income Estimation: 
$143,123 - $179,960
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at Dee Zee

Dee Zee
Hired Organization Address Des Moines, IA Full Time
POSITION SUMMARY — Analyze, design, develop, test, document, and implement new or modify existing software to meet ongoi...
Dee Zee
Hired Organization Address Des Moines, IA Full Time
POSITION SUMMARY – Conduct inspections to determine quality of raw materials, in-process parts, and finished goods. Perf...
Dee Zee
Hired Organization Address Des Moines, IA Full Time
As the EHS Specialist, you will play a key role in supporting the Environmental, Health, and Safety (EHS) Manager in dev...
Dee Zee
Hired Organization Address Des Moines, IA Full Time
POSITION SUMMARY — Monitor and audit all departments to ensure company products are meet or exceed the quality requireme...

Not the job you're looking for? Here are some other 17Software Developer 2 jobs in the Des Moines, IA area that may be a better fit.

Cobol Developer | Application Developer

Robert Half, Des Moines, IA

UI Developer

Accord Technologies Inc, Des Moines, IA

AI Assistant is available now!

Feel free to start your new journey!